Yes — with 11.1 GB to spare

Llama 3.2 3B Instruct at Q4_K_M fits your GeForce RTX 4060 Ti 16 GB entirely on the GPU at 8K context, at an estimated 97 tokens per second. Past 109K the KV cache pushes it over — quantise the cache to q8_0, or step down a quantisation, to go longer.

Quantisation ladder

QuantWeightsTotal @ 8KMax contextTok/sQualityFit
F16 6.0 GB 7.5 GB 71K 29 Reference Long context
Q8_0 3.2 GB 4.7 GB 97K 55 −0.1% ppl Long context
Q6_K 2.5 GB 3.9 GB 103K 71 −0.4% ppl Long context
Q5_K_M 2.1 GB 3.6 GB 106K 82 −0.8% ppl Long context
Q4_K_M 1.8 GB 3.3 GB 109K 97 −1.9% ppl Recommended
Q3_K_M 1.5 GB 2.9 GB 112K 119 −5.4% ppl Long context
Q2_K 1.3 GB 2.7 GB 114K 139 −15% ppl Long context

Quality is the published perplexity delta against f16 weights. Max context assumes an f16 KV cache; q8_0 roughly doubles it.

How to run it

terminal
$ ollama pull llama3.2:3b
$ OLLAMA_CONTEXT_LENGTH=8192 \
    ollama run llama3.2:3b

The default. One binary, a model registry, an OpenAI-compatible port. More on Ollama.

01Download is 1.8 GB. Keep it on an SSD — a first load off a spinning disk takes minutes.
02Close anything else holding VRAM. A browser with hardware acceleration can sit on 1–2 GB.
03There is room to go to 109K context on this card.
